Which irrational number can be added to Pi to get a sum that is rational?
StartFraction 1 Over pi EndFraction
Negative StartFraction 1 Over pi EndFraction
Negative pi
Pi

To determine which irrational number can be added to \(\pi\) to result in a rational sum, we need to analyze the effects of adding each of the provided options:

1. **\(\frac{1}{\pi}\)**: This number is also irrational. The sum \(\pi + \frac{1}{\pi}\) would still be irrational.

2. **\(-\frac{1}{\pi}\)**: This number is irrational as well. The sum \(\pi - \frac{1}{\pi}\) remains irrational.

3. **\(-\pi\)**: This is also irrational. The sum \(\pi - \pi\) equals \(0\), which is rational.

4. **\(\pi\)**: Adding \(\pi\) to \(\pi\) gives \(2\pi\), which is still irrational.

Out of these options, the only one that can be added to \(\pi\) to yield a rational number is \(-\pi\).

Therefore, the answer is: **\(-\pi\)**.
